Develop a Favorable Way Of Thinking



To make certain an effective first dental check out for your youngster, it is very important to develop a favorable frame of mind. Begin by speaking with your youngster about the visit in a tranquil and encouraging fashion. Highlight that going to the dentist is a typical part of dealing with their teeth and that the dental expert exists to help keep their smile healthy and balanced. Stay clear of using unfavorable words or phrases that might develop anxiety or stress and anxiety.

Rather, focus on the favorable elements, such as getting to see cool oral tools or receiving a sticker or plaything at the end of the visit. Urge your child to ask concerns and reveal any kind of concerns they might have.

Equip Your Child With Healthy Dental Habits



Establishing healthy and balanced oral behaviors is vital for your kid's oral health and wellness and overall health. By educating your child excellent dental behaviors from a very early age, you can assist protect against dental caries, gum tissue illness, and various other oral wellness problems.



Begin by showing them the relevance of cleaning their teeth twice a day, ut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ride tooth paste. Program them the appropriate cleaning method, making sure they clean all surface areas of their teeth and gum tissues.

Urge them to floss daily to eliminate plaque and food fragments from between their teeth.

Limitation their consumption of sugary treats and beverages, as these can add to tooth decay.

Lastly, schedule regular oral exams for your child to preserve their oral health and deal with any type of issues at an early stage.
